Responsibilities
  • Drive and implement strategic objectives for the process and quality division.
  • Analyse plant losses and lead cost-reduction initiatives.
  • Develop and execute annual improvement plans aligned with operational goals.
  • Manage and mentor direct reports, fostering a high-performance culture.
  • Promote a safe, inclusive and innovative work environment.
  • Ensure compliance with company safety, health and environmental policies.
  • Formulate and manage cost-effective raw material and packaging strategies.
  • Maintain and improve product performance based on customer and market feedback.
  • Ensure adherence to national quality standards (e.g. SANS 266).
  • Oversee compliance with ISO 9001:2015 and support World Class Manufacturing (WCM) initiatives.
  • Sustain and improve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S) and QMS outputs.
  • Lead new product development in collaboration with marketing and sales teams.
  • Ensure QMS integrity during change implementation.
  • Promote a culture of customer focus and continuous improvement.
  • Deliver on agreed quality and control plan targets.
Requirements
  • BEng or equivalent in Chemical Engineering (essential)
  • Qualification in Quality Control / Management (advantageous)
  • Minimum 5 years in a chemical / process / quality engineering role
  • Prior experience in quality and project management
  • Exposure to WCM, Lean or Six Sigma methodologies (advantageous)
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ving and planning skills
  • Effective communicator with strong report writing and presentation ability
  • Computer literate (Word, Excel, PowerPoint; Visio and Python advantageous)
  • Capable of managing multiple projects simultaneously with a high degree of accuracy and detail
